According to the FDA Adverse Event Reporting System (FAERS), 49 reports of Cytopenia have been filed in association with THIOTEPA (Thiotepa). This represents 0.7% of all adverse event reports for THIOTEPA.

How Dangerous Is Cytopenia From THIOTEPA?
Of the 49 reports, 10 (20.4%) resulted in death, 15 (30.6%) required hospitalization, and 5 (10.2%) were considered life-threatening.
Is Cytopenia Listed in the Official Label?
Yes, Cytopenia is listed as a known adverse reaction in the official FDA drug label for THIOTEPA.
